    Should I get a pressure washer?

    Don't let the scare stories mislead you. The only time a pressure washer will do harm to your car paint is if you've got a catastrophic failure of the clearcote or heavy rust already. With that said using a pressure washer and lance correct usage is a must, don't get too close using the lance...

    Cleaning car carpet floor mats

    With respect I've been using stiff nylon brushes to agitate stains out of carpets and mats for years. It goes without saying to use it with care (ie not too much pressure and not too aggressively) but used correctly can remove the stain quickly and effectively.

    interior detailing

    I just use a good wet'dry vacuum cleaner. Spray on interior shampoo, agitate with a stiff nylon brush and vacuum up.
